[jira] Created: (MRELEASE-186) Active profiles are not carried through into the release descriptor

Active profiles are not carried through into the release descriptor
-------------------------------------------------------------------

                 Key: MRELEASE-186
                 URL: http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MRELEASE-186
             Project: Maven 2.x Release Plugin
          Issue Type: Bug
    Affects Versions: 2.0-beta-4
            Reporter: Jason van Zyl


When using a profile for a release it is not passed on in the release.properties so it's not executed in the perform goal.
